17. Wrap or tie jacket
The chiffon pleated shrug (below) works on lots of levels. The tie waist will help to cover a tummy, the deep v-neck creates flattering lines, and the draped sleeves will cover your upper arms without clinging. Reviewers say it adds the perfect touch to a dress, or can be worn with a tank top and jeans.
